Post by: the Ward on April 05, 2013, 07:03:16 AM
Lol!I just went on muellers website to check it out.That MX looks and functions like the Ulta-Dot sight,which is a very good red dot sight.I put an Ultra Dot on a 870 slug gun back in 89' or 90' and the thing is still going strong!Sold that gun to a friend,who sold it to another friend who still has it.Neither of them are particularly easy on equipment,it's accounted for a lot of deer over the years.So if the Mueller sight is based on the Ultra dot design i would imagine it would be good.Alot of guys were running mueller quickshots and loving them a little while back,maybe some of them could chime in and update how their holding up.I been wanting a burris ff for a couple seasons now but i'm like you,just can't swing it this season.Hopefully next season ff3 or even looking at the tac30,gives me something to daydream about this summer lol!......ward

Post by: the Ward on April 05, 2013, 07:19:53 AM
Right now i have a bushnell trs25 red dot.I put it on my vinci about a month ago to get it set up for turkey season,been doing alot of patterning and so far it's held zero shooting 3'lead out of a 6.9lb.gun,so time will tell how durable it is.My wife got it for me for christms this year,it was on sale for $84 with free shipping from midway.I think Bushnell has a rebate going on right now on them.It is a very small,compact sight.    ward
